The 6 STEMI Equivalents:




* Posterior MI

* ST Depression V2/V3 (or STE in V7-V9)





* Right Ventricular MI

* STE V1 associated with inferior MI ; or STE V4R-V6R





* Wellens Syndrome

* Type A: Biphasic T-waves V2/3



* Type B: Deep Symmetric T-wave Inversion V2/V3





* De Winter’s T Wave

* ST Depression with a large, symmetric, upright T wave





* STE avR with diffuse ST-Depression

* Usually a strain pattern due to underlying pathology, in correct clinical context can represent a left main or proximal LAD coronary occlusion





* Modified Sgarbossa Criteria in LBBB

* Concordant STE in any lead



* Concordant ST Depression in V1-V3



* Excessive Discordance (ST/S ratio >0.25)






Other atypical ischemic EKG findings:




* Isolated TWI in avL – early sign of inferior MI



* Hyperacute TWave



* NTTV1 (New Tall T-wave in V1)
